What Are Smart Kiosks?

Smart kiosks are touch-screen-enabled, internet-connected devices designed to deliver real-time information and assist users with a variety of tasks. Whether it’s helping customers order food, providing wayfinding assistance in a large venue, or showcasing product details in retail, these kiosks enhance user experience while driving business efficiency.

Business Applications:

These are finding a strong foothold across various industries. Here’s how they’re making a difference:

  • Retail

Smart kiosks streamline the shopping experience by offering product recommendations, availability checks, and promotions. Paired with analytics tools, they also provide valuable insights into consumer behavior, helping businesses optimize store layouts and promotions.

  • Hospitality and Food Service

From self-ordering kiosks in fast-food restaurants to hotel check-in kiosks, businesses are using this technology to improve service speed and reduce labor costs.

  • Healthcare

In hospitals and clinics, kiosks are being used to manage patient check-ins, display real-time appointment data, and reduce wait times by providing information at strategic points.

  • Corporate and Campus Environments

Large corporate campuses and educational institutions utilize smart kiosks for wayfinding, event scheduling, and connecting employees or students with relevant services.

  • Security and Privacy Concerns

As with any IoT-enabled technology, security and privacy are significant considerations. They are often collected end- user data to personalize services, creating potential risks if proper security measures aren’t implemented. Integrators must prioritize robust encryption protocols, user consent management, and secure data storage solutions when deploying smart kiosks.
